Method
Preparation
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- On a lightly floured surface, roll out the puff pastry to about 1/8 inch thick and transfer it to a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- Score a border about 1-inch from the edge of the pastry without cutting all the way through.
- Wash and trim the asparagus, then arrange them evenly over the puff pastry.
- Spread the crumbled goat cheese generously over the arranged asparagus.
- Drizzle olive oil over the tart and season with salt and pepper.
- Beat the egg in a small bowl and brush it over the exposed edges of the pastry.
Baking
- Place the tart in the preheated oven and bake for about 20-25 minutes or until golden brown and puffed.
- Once baked, allow the tart to cool slightly, garnish with fresh herbs if desired, slice, and serve warm.
Notes
If you have leftovers, store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at in the oven at 350°F (180°C) for 10-15 minutes for best texture.
